In a JP Morgan HireVue interview, candidates typically encounter a mix of behavioral and situational questions. While the specific questions can vary depending on the role, here are some common types of questions you might encounter:

Tell me about a time you faced a challenge at work. How did you handle it?

Why do you want to work at JP Morgan?
